Specifications include, but are not limited to: Pursuant to: (1) the LoanSTAR (Saving Taxes and Resources) Revolving Loan Program of the Texas State Energy Plan (“SEP”) in accordance with the Energy Policy and Conservation Act (42 U.S.C. 6321, et seq.), as amended by the Energy Conservation and Production Act (42 U.S.C. 6326, et seq.); (2) the Oil Overcharge Restitutionary Act, Chapter 2305 of the Texas Government Code; and (3) Title 34, Texas Administrative Code, Chapter 19, Subchapter D Loan Program for Energy Retrofits; the Texas Comptroller of Public Accounts (“Comptroller”) and the State Energy Conservation Office (“SECO”) announces its Small School District Pilot HVAC Loan Program Notice of Loan Fund Availability and Request for Applications No. BE-G13-2014 (“NOLFA/RFA”) and invites applications from eligible interested small public K-12 independent school districts for loan assistance to implement building HVAC-related cost-reduction retrofit projects. This program is for replacement of existing HVAC systems.
